A nurse is preparing to take an oral temperature. Which client action will require the nurse to
delay the procedure?
A. Drinking cold water 20 minutes ago
✔✔B. Smoking a cigarette 5 minutes ago
C. Sitting in a chair quietly for 10 minutes
D. Wearing light clothing indoors
A nurse is assisting a client to ambulate for the first time after surgery. Which action is most
important?
A. Use a gait belt
✔✔B. Assess the client’s balance before walking
C. Instruct the client to walk quickly
D. Keep the IV fluid bag below heart level
A client with an indwelling catheter complains of bladder discomfort. The nurse’s first action
should be to:

,A. Increase oral fluids
✔✔B. Check for catheter kinks or blockage
C. Remove the catheter immediately
D. Notify the provider
A nurse prepares to administer a liquid oral medication to a child. Which device should be used
for the most accurate dose?
A. Medicine cup
✔✔B. Oral syringe
C. Teaspoon
D. Dropper without measurement markings
A nurse is teaching a client about incentive spirometer use. Which instruction is correct?
✔✔A. Inhale slowly and deeply through the mouthpiece
B. Exhale quickly into the device
C. Use the device once daily
D. Hold breath for 1 second only

,A nurse enters a room and finds a small fire in a wastebasket. The nurse’s first action is to:
A. Use the fire extinguisher
✔✔B. Move the client to safety
C. Call maintenance
D. Open the windows for ventilation
A nurse is applying a nasal cannula to a client. Which oxygen flow rate is appropriate for this
device?
A. 10 L/min
✔✔B. 2 L/min
C. 8 L/min
D. 12 L/min
A nurse is caring for a client with a wound. Which finding indicates infection?
A. Pink wound edges
✔✔B. Purulent drainage
C. Minimal swelling
D. Clean granulation tissue

, A nurse is reinforcing teaching about the DASH diet. Which food choice indicates
understanding?
A. Bacon and eggs
B. Canned soup and crackers
✔✔C. Fresh fruit and vegetables
D. White bread and butter
A nurse is helping a client with a right-sided weakness transfer from bed to chair. Which side
should the nurse place the chair?
A. Weak side
✔✔B. Strong side
C. Either side
D. Behind the bed
